How much does it cost to rent a home in Orchard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Orchard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,001 | $900 | $3,000 |
| Orchard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,360 | $1,695 | $3,250 |
| Orchard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,563 | $2,200 | $2,999 |
| Orchard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,777 | $2,600 | $2,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Orchard Park
What type of rentals are currently available in Orchard Park?
There are currently 152 Apartments for Rent in Orchard Park, ON with pricing that ranges from $574 to $11,330. There are also 193 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Orchard Park ranging from $750 to $3,250.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Orchard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Orchard Park ranges from $750 to $3,250 with an average monthly rent of $2,075.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Orchard Park?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Orchard Park range from $722 to $2,195,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,695 to $3,250.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,595.
